    any time i try and convert using the aac(cli) it says that the codec could not be opened.what could be the problem

    Click the "Locate Encoder" button for the AAC (CLI) Codec and browse until you find the .exe its looking for. You probably didn't install dMC to the default directory, so you need to change the path. The .exe should be in the Compression folder under something like "AAC (CLI)" and then the .exe itself.
